(KSL News) -- People in a Mapleton neighborhood that have been ordered to boil their drinking water will find out tomorrow if their water is safe to drink again.

Tests over the weekend discovered part of the city's water system had been contaminated with e-coli, after heavy rain flooded one of the culinary water springs.

So as a precaution residents who live in the southwest area of Mapleton are asked to boil water for drinking, food preparation and dishwashing.

The problem has been fixed and results from water samples are expected back tomorrow.
